Window Wells Repair in Denver, CO
Window well repair services focus on restoring and maintaining the structural integrity of window wells that surround basement windows. These repairs often address issues such as corroded or damaged metal, cracked or collapsed walls, and drainage problems that can lead to water intrusion or flooding. Projects may include replacing rusted or broken components, sealing leaks, or installing new window well covers to improve safety and functionality. Homeowners typically seek these services to prevent water damage, improve basement security, and ensure proper drainage around basement windows.
Before requesting window well repair,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the damage, the materials involved, and the best solutions for their specific situation. It’s important to assess whether the repair involves simple patching or requires more extensive work like replacing entire sections of the well. Clarifying the cause of issues, such as poor drainage or corrosion, can help determine the most effective repair approach. Properly repaired window wells contribute to basement dryness, prevent structural deterioration, and enhance overall property safety.

Common Window Wells Repair Jobs
Window well repairs - restoring the structural integrity of existing window wells to prevent water intrusion.
Leak prevention - sealing and patching damaged areas to keep basements dry during heavy rain.
Rust and corrosion treatment - removing rust and applying protective coatings to extend the lifespan of metal window wells.
Drainage upgrades - improving water flow around window wells to reduce flooding risks.
Egress window well repairs - fixing or replacing window wells to meet safety and egress requirements.
Cover and grate replacement - installing new covers to enhance safety and prevent debris from entering window wells.
Window Wells Repair Questions
What causes window wells to need repair? Common issues include rust, cracks, leaks, or displacement that can compromise their effectiveness and safety.
How can damaged window wells affect a home? They can lead to water seepage, basement flooding, and potential structural damage if not repaired promptly.
What types of repairs are typically performed on window wells? Repairs often involve sealing leaks, replacing rusted or broken covers, and repositioning displaced wells.
Is it possible to prevent window well damage? Regular inspections and maintenance can help identify issues early and prevent more significant problems later.
